The invention relates to devices for variably restricting the flow of fluids in which flow resistance is varied by varying the length of a flow path defined by the device.
It is known to provide flow restricting devices in which the flow resistance is varied by varying the length of a flow path defined therethrough rather than by reducing the cross-sectional area of the flow path, as is the case with a tapering needle and orifice for example. An advantage of not reducing the flow path cross-sectional area is that the likelihood of the device becoming blocked by debris or lime scale is reduced. Additionally, it is possible by placing upstream of the device a filter having a pore size smaller than the flow path section area to ensure that particles entrained in the fluid which reach the device will generally not be of sufficient size to cause a blockage.
In a known flow restricting device having a variable length flow path, an axially extending helical groove is provided which can be selectively covered by relative axial movement between the part defining the groove and a suitable cover to provide a flow path, or passage, having a length which is variable. A disadvantage with such devices is that they are not economical with space due to the requirement for axial movement and may not be suitable for applications where space is limited.
One object of the invention is to provide an improved variable flow restricting device which can be made compact.
Accordingly, the invention provides a variable flow restricting device comprising a part having groove means provided in a face thereof and through-passage means communicating with said groove means, covering means for engaging said face for covering said groove means to define flow path means which extend from said through-passage means in communication therewith, and means for providing relative displacement between said part and said covering means for causing resilient deformation of said covering means and/or said part to provide adjustably variable covering of said groove means such that said flow path means extends from said through-passage means to an extent which is adjustably variable according to said relative displacement.
The invention also includes a variable flow restricting device including parts cooperable together to form a flow path extending progressively radially outwardly from an inlet defined in at least one of the parts and means for progressively controlling the degree of cooperation between said parts for progressively varying the length of said flow path from said inlet.
The invention additionally includes a valve apparatus comprising a variable flow restricting apparatus as defined in either one of the last two preceding paragraphs.
The covering means may be disposed between said displacement providing means and said face so as to be displaceable by said displacement providing means.
Preferably, the covering means comprises a resiliently deformable member and a resilient membrane disposed between said deformable member and said face.
Preferably, the deformable member comprises a dome-shaped portion having a generally convex face directed toward said resilient membrane and the membrane includes a generally convex face directed toward said face of said part. In which case, the radius of curvature of said convex face of the deformable member is preferably smaller than the radius of curvature of said convex face of said resilient membrane.
The deformable member may comprise means for mutually slideably engaging with said resilient membrane.
The deformable member may be mounted on a relatively rigid moveable member.
The displacement means may engage said moveable member.
Preferably, the deformable member comprises a polymeric material.
Advantageously, the polymeric material is a rubber.
Preferably, the face of the part is flat and the groove means comprises a spiral groove extending radially outwardly from said through-passage means.
